There are 43 Kilgores of Virginia in Barnett McConnell's book but no Sarah Elizabeth or Malinda.
If you hit a brick wall concerning Milburn Nichols, you may find something in "Kilgore" by Hugh M. Addington, "History of Addington family" by Hugh Addington, "History of Scott Co., Virginia" (1932) by Professor Milford Addington, "Ledger of Pioneer Families; Nicklesville Area of Southwestern Virginia" by H. D. (Kay) Kilgore, and"Regular Baptist minutes, Copper Creek church 1809-1896" by Luther F. Addington and Emory L. Hamilton.
Some places to look is at Book Stores in Nicklesville (internet and phone book), Local library in Nicklesville ( best bet. sometimes a researcher is available), State Archives in Richmond, VA, Scott's Co., Historical Society, Virginia Historical Society. Plus of course Family History Center close to you may be able to get them for you from Salt Lake City if theyhave been put on film or fiche.
